Font Size: a A A

The Business Process Prediction Based On Machine Learning

Posted on:2020-04-21Degree:MasterType:Thesis
Country:ChinaCandidate:L CuiFull Text:PDF
GTID:2428330572473624Subject:Computer technology
Abstract/Summary:PDF Full Text Request
Process mining is a combination of business process and data mining.Today,the research of process mining focuses on the business processes prediction.The main tasks of business process monitoring are:the prediction of the next activity,the prediction of the future path(continuation)with a running case,the prediction of the remaining cycle time,the prediction of the deadline violations and predicting the fulfillment of a property upon completion.This paper mainly proposes the methods to solve the problems of the prediction of the next activity and timestamp,the prediction of the future path(continuation)of a running case and the remaining cycle time,the prediction of the results,then packages these methods into a prediction module.Finally,the prediction module is applied to the actual application,and a prototype system of business process monitoring and prediction is constructed.This paper proposes two prediction models for three prediction tasks.One model is used to predict the results of the process.A method using the Long Short-Term Memory model in deep learning is proposed for predicting the results of the process.The main purpose is to combine the prediction problem of process results with the natural language processing and propose a new solution.Another model is used to predict the time and event activity of business process.This model could solve two tasks which are predicting the next activity and timestamp,predicting the future path(continuation)of a running case and the remaining cycle time.This paper proposes a idea that use the Gated Recurrent Unit,the Bidirectional RNNs,the Attention technique and the Word2vec embedding method in natural language processing for business process prediction.The aim of the approach is to find the right technologies for business process prediction tasks with natural language processing.After studying the forecasting methods of three predicting tasks in depth,this paper constructs a prototype system of business process monitoring and forecasting by using the predicting methods.This prototype system mainly obtains the monitoring information of the running status of the business process being executed,and can predict the process results,activities and time.The system aims to enable users to monitor the running status of business process in real time and optimize the process in time by predicting its follow-up.
Keywords/Search Tags:predicting business process, machine learning, deep learning, buisness monitorting
PDF Full Text Request
Related items